Half-Life 2 RTX: a visual masterpiece (if your PC survives)
Half-Life 2 RTX, created by Orbifold Studios, is out today, bringing City 17 to life like never before. This stunning overhaul, powered by RTX Remix, features full ray tracing, AI-enhanced RTX Neural Rendering, the fluid performance of NVIDIA DLSS 4 with Multi Frame Generation, and ultra-responsive gameplay with NVIDIA Reflex. Keep in mind that this is a mod – you’ll need to own Half-Life 2 on Steam to play it. Plus, it’s just a demo featuring two chapters of the game.

Here are the minimum system requirements:
- OS: Windows 10 / Windows 11
- Processor: Intel i5-8600, AMD Ryzen 5 3600
- Memory: 16 GB
- Graphics: N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 Ti
- Free Space: 50GB
Would love to see the recommended requirements, especially since early feedback isn’t looking great. Seems like a bunch of players are already running into the blue screen of death and errors with Half-Life 2 RTX.
